【excel如何修改不同工作簿下的数据引用】在使用 Excel 进行多工作簿数据联动时,常常会遇到需要修改外部数据引用的情况。例如,当一个工作簿引用了另一个工作簿中的数据时,如果目标工作簿的路径、名称或数据结构发生变化,原有的引用可能会失效,导致错误或无法显示数据。本文将总结如何在 Excel 中修改不同工作簿之间的数据引用。
一、常见问题与原因
| 问题现象 | 可能原因 |
| 数据无法显示 | 引用的工作簿未打开或路径错误 |
| 错误提示(如 REF!) | 引用的工作簿被删除或移动 |
| 数据更新不及时 | 引用公式未正确设置为自动更新 |
二、修改不同工作簿数据引用的方法
1. 手动修改公式
- 步骤:
1. 打开包含引用公式的源工作簿。
2. 定位到需要修改的单元格。
3. 在公式栏中查看当前的引用格式,例如:`=[Book2.xlsx]Sheet1!A1`。
4. 修改为新的工作簿名称或路径,如:`=[NewBook.xlsx]Sheet1!A1`。
5. 按回车键确认修改。
> 注意:若目标工作簿未打开,需确保其路径正确,否则公式可能无法正常加载数据。
2. 使用“编辑链接”功能
- 步骤:
1. 点击菜单栏中的【数据】选项卡。
2. 选择【编辑链接】。
3. 在弹出的窗口中,可以看到所有外部引用。
4. 选中需要修改的链接,点击【更改源】。
5. 浏览并选择新的工作簿文件,点击【确定】。
6. 最后点击【确定】关闭对话框。
> 优点:可一次性管理多个外部链接,避免手动逐个修改。
3. 更新链接设置
- 步骤:
1. 同样在【数据】选项卡中,点击【编辑链接】。
2. 选择【全部刷新】,以更新所有外部数据引用。
3. 如果链接失效,可以选择【断开链接】或【删除链接】。
三、注意事项
| 注意事项 | 说明 |
| 路径一致性 | 外部工作簿的路径最好保持一致,避免因路径变化导致引用失败 |
| 文件权限 | 若工作簿存储在网络路径下,需确保有访问权限 |
| 自动更新 | 设置公式为“自动更新”,避免手动刷新带来不便 |
| 避免频繁修改 | 频繁修改引用可能导致数据混乱,建议做好备份 |
四、总结
在 Excel 中修改不同工作簿的数据引用,主要可以通过手动调整公式、使用“编辑链接”功能以及更新链接设置等方式实现。操作过程中需要注意路径、权限和更新方式,以保证数据引用的准确性和稳定性。合理管理外部链接,可以有效提升工作效率和数据准确性。
| 方法 | 适用场景 | 是否推荐 |
| 手动修改公式 | 单个或少量引用 | 推荐 |
| 编辑链接 | 多个引用或批量修改 | 推荐 |
| 更新链接设置 | 需要刷新数据时 | 推荐 |


